Subject: Rotating the AddrSnap widget key

Hi plugin folks,

We're rotating the key that the AddrSnap address autocomplete widget uses to reach our internal suggestion service. The current key expires next Tuesday, after which lookups will return 401s and your dropdowns will go quiet. Please swap in the new key in your plugin config before then — it's a one-line change. No other settings move. The replacement key is just below.

app token of bawep-hafog = kto7_vwrmnlx

# Map-tile prefetcher settings (Wrenpath project)
# Heads up, future folks: the prefetcher warms tiles around recent
# viewport centers, pulled nightly from the usage table. Keep the
# radius under 6 or you'll hammer the tile cache. Skipping oceans is
# intentional — don't "fix" it. The usage table lives in the analytics
# database; connect with the string below.

primary connection of yagep-kahip = redis://giliel_svc:zYiKsLL2PLpfPL@db-348f.xolmarsys.corp:5432/fenwyn

**Q: Why is the user module split across two packages in this PR?**

We're carving the user module out of the Hollowgate monolith gradually — auth logic moves to the new service, profile data stays behind for now. Review for boundary leaks, not for completeness. The migration plan lives in the Carver wiki. Questions about the split's scope go to the extraction team here.

alerts address for kajog-tadup: druox@plorvanet.internal